G2 and Astralis start lower bracket runs with victories
Liquid and ENCE go home after back-to-back defeats in Group B.
Astralis and G2 will continue their lower bracket run at IEM Katowice 2022 after defeating ENCE and Liquid, respectively. The winners have advanced to the next round of Group B's lower bracket and will wait for the results of the upper semis to find out their opponents.
Despite showing good form, ENCE were unable to continue their adventure in Poland, giving Natus Vincere a run for their money in the opening series of the group stage before being sent home after a hard-fought match against Astralis.
Meanwhile, the new-look Liquid go home counting only one map to their name, earned during the 1-2 defeat against FaZe. Unfortunately for the North Americans, G2's opening loss to fnatic meant that they would be facing the European squad to give themselves a chance to reach the Spodek Arena.

The main stream saw Astralis and ENCE fight for tournament survival, starting off on the European's pick of Mirage. ENCE played a great T side, with newcomer Pavle "Maden" Bošković creating some quality moments during the 9-6 half. With Olek "hades" Miskiewicz also playing in top form after switching to the defense, ENCE were able to claim map point at 15-12 before a late Danish comeback forced the match into overtime. Extra time turned out to just be delaying the inevitable as ENCE moved to gain series advantage with a 19-16 victory.
Facing elimination, Astralis got to work on the T side of Overpass, but it was not an easy fight. Despite Lukas "gla1ve" Rossander's team taking the opening pistol to gain a 4-0 lead, the half remained competitive until the very end, with Astralis barely claiming a 8-7 lead thanks to Benjamin "blameF" Bremer's incredible performance. The rifler did not slow down for a second as he led his team through a tough CT half, closing the map 16-12 with a 30-15 K-D and 112.0 ADR.
ENCE started off the series decider on Ancient in great form, claiming an early 3-0 advantage before very quickly going very flat. Once the rifles started coming out, Astralis began their resurgence on the CT side as Kristian "k0nfig" Wienecke, Philip "Lucky" Ewald, and blameF started taking over the game. The Danes strung together a six-round winning streak before closing the half 9-6 ahead.
A sloppy start to the second half saw the two teams constantly exchange rounds before ENCE were able to establish themselves in the game with a four-round winning streak. Despite Maden and hades playing at the top of their level, it was not enough for the Europeans to retake the lead, collapsing in the last round of play to give Astralis the map 16-13 and a hard-fought 2-1 series victory.

The second elimination match got started on Liquid's pick of Vertigo, but it was G2 that easily gained the upper hand thanks to an incredible performance from Nikola "NiKo" Kovač. The Bosnian superstar shut down Liquid on ramp time and time again, denying the chance for the North Americans to make their way into A. Despite Jonathan "EliGE" Jablonowski's best efforts, Liquid were only able to grab a few sporadic rounds, going into the break trailing 5-10 behind.
Moving to the CT side, the North Americans had seemingly found another lifeline after winning the pistol round but G2 wasted no time in putting those hopes down, converting the following force buy. From there, the Europeans would only concede two rounds as they cruised to seal a 16-8 scoreline. Alongside NiKo, Ilya "m0NESY" Osipov also turned up to play, ending the map with a 28-11 K-D and 112.7 ADR.
Liquid's early pistol round did not lead to much as G2 once again converted the force buy, immediately putting Nick "nitr0" Cannella and co. on the back foot. The cousins NiKo and Nemanja "huNter-" Kovač really tried their best to not repeat the mistakes from their previous series, steamrolling the North Americans with a combined 39 frags in the 11-4 offensive half. Switching sides felt like groundhog day, with Liquid taking the pistol and G2 responding in spectacular fashion with another force buy victory. From there, the match was in the hands of the Europeans, easily sailing to a 16-5 victory and completing the 2-0 stomp.
